P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a manufacturing method for a thrust roller bearing for reducing differential slide and friction wear and providing long service life in resistance to peeling-off. SOLUTION: This manufacturing method comprises a process for forming the holder having the pocket 3 storing double rows of rollers 2 and a process for arranging all of the double rows of rollers in the pocket as rollers 2a with crowning to reduce differential slide, although contact face pressure rises above contact face pressure applied on each roller when all of the double rows of rollers are straight rollers.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a whole roller type rolling bearing, which can be adapted to tendency of a high speed and a heavy load in application and a low viscosity of a lubricating oil. SOLUTION: This rolling bearing comprises an outer ring 4, an inner ring 2 and a roller 3 all made of steel, wherein at least one of the outer ring, the inner ring and the roller is provided with a carbonitriding layer on the surface layer, and the grain sizes of the austenitic crystals on the surface layer are a specified value or larger.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a product with high strength and long service life by increasing occurrence load of impression or crack when impact load and big load act on an outer ring, in a bearing where the outer periphery of the outer ring rotates while rolling and contacting with a partner cam or a guiding surface. SOLUTION: The bearing comprises the outer ring 4, a rolling element 3, and an inner ring 2. In addition to a rolling surface disposed inside surrounded with the outer ring, the outer peripheral surface of the outer ring is used as the rolling surface. A compressive stress is formed in a surface layer section of the rolling surface at least inside the outer ring. COPYRIGHT: (C)2004,JPO

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a rolling part which has an extended life as long as that of ball bearing steel and is prepared by using steel of a medium carbon steel level improved in the characteristics of preventing the occurrence of surface cracks; and a power transmission part including the rolling part. SOLUTION: The rolling part is made of steel of which the lower limit ΔKth of the stress intensity factor ranges corresponding to the progress of tensile fatigue crack in an induction-hardened section is 6.2 MPa√m or higher.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a rolling contact part which has characteristics equal to or more than those of a part made from SCM 420 while adopting a material free from Mo, and a rolling bearing.SOLUTION: An outer ring 11, an inner ring 12, and a ball 13 are formed from a steel containing 0.15 mass% or more and 0.25 mass% or less of carbon; 0.45 mass% or more and 0.55 mass% or less of silicon; 1.05 mass% or more and 1.15 mass% or less of manganese; and 1.40 mass% or more and 1.50 mass% or less of chromium, with the balance being iron and impurities respectively, and the surfaces thereof respectively have an outer ring rolling surface 11A, an inner ring rolling surface 12A and a ball contact surface 13A to make rolling contact with other members. An outer ring carburized layer 11B, an inner ring carburized layer 12B and a ball carburized layer 13B are formed respectively so as to include the outer ring rolling surface 11A, inner ring rolling surface 12A and ball contact surface 13A.

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a high frequency hardening method capable of obtaining high durability in rolling fatigue or the like by micronizing the micro-structure and obtaining a high surface hardness, and steel parts. SOLUTION: The high frequency hardening method comprises a process of hardening steel parts by high-frequency heating, and a process of performing a high frequency-heating beyond point A 3 and cooling to transformation point A 1 or lower, which is performed at least one time before the above hardening process. Furthermore, it comprises, in the high-frequency heating beyond the point A 3 before the hardening process, a process of holding the steel parts within a temperature region beyond the point A 3 for a prescribed time or longer, then cooling the steel parts to the transformation point A 1 or lower as they are.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a rolling member and a rolling bearing for a transmission, which exhibit the long life under harsh environments while reducing a content of an alloying element. SOLUTION: An outer race 11, an inner race 12 and a ball 13 of a deep groove ball bearing 1 are made of a steel which comprises 0.7 to 1.1% carbon, 0.3 to 0.7% silicon, 0.3 to 0.8% manganese, 0.5 to 1.2% nickel, 1.3 to 1.8% chromium, 0.1 to 0.7% molybdenum, 0.2 to 0.4% vanadium and the balance iron with impurities, while controlling a total content of silicon and manganese to 1.0% or less, a total content of nickel and chromium to 2.3% or more and a total content of chromium, molybdenum and vanadium to 3.0% or less; and have a layer containing high carbon formed on their surfaces. The surface layer part of the layer has a hardness of 725 to 800 HV. The maximum particle size of carbides dispersed in the surface layer part is 10 μm or smaller and the area ratio thereof is 7 to 20% or less. The surface layer part includes more carbon than the inner part by 0.2 to 0.4%, and includes nitrogen of 0.1 to 0.5 mass%. COPYRIGHT: (C)2009,JPO&INPIT

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a rolling member that has the long life even in a high-temperature environment and an environment into which water enters, while having a controlled content of an alloy element; a rolling bearing; and a method for manufacturing the rolling member. SOLUTION: An outer ring 11, an inner ring 12 and a ball 13 which compose a deep groove ball bearing 1 are formed of a steel material comprising 0.3 to 0.4% carbon, 0.3 to 0.7% silicon, 0.3 to 0.8% manganese, 0.5 to 1.2% nickel, 1.6 to 2.5% chromium, 0.1 to 0.7% molybdenum, 0.2 to 0.4% vanadium, while controlling the contents of silicon + manganese, nickel + chromium and chromium + molybdenum + vanadium to 1.0% or less, 2.3% or more and 3.0% or less respectively, and the balance iron with impurities; and have a hardened layer formed thereon. The hardened layer has such a surface layer that hardness is 725 to 800 HV, and carbides have the maximum particle size of 10 μm or smaller and occupy 7 to 25% or less by an area rate; and has an inner part in which hardness is 450 to 650 HV. P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a bearing device for a wheel having high durability achieved by using a component having a non-hardened portion with increased fatigue strength. SOLUTION: The bearing device 1 for the wheel has an outer member 10, an inner member 20 and rollers 50. The inner member 20 is made of steel and includes a hub ring 30 on which a wheel installation flange 31 is formed. The hub ring 30 has a hardened section 39 hardened to the hardness of 50 HRC or higher by quenching, and also has a non-hardened section 33 that is the section other than the hardened section 39. The ferrite area ratio of steel forming the non-hardened section 33 is 3% or less. COPYRIGHT: (C)2008,JPO&INPIT
